How Our Tile Floor Water Extraction Service Works
When you call our team for tile floor water extraction, you can expect a thorough and efficient process. Our technicians will arrive quickly, assess the situation, and begin extracting water from your tile floors using specialized equipment. Here’s a breakdown of our process:
Step 1: Assessment and Preparation
Inspecting the affected area to identify the source of the water damage and assess the extent of the damage. Our technicians will also take note of any areas that may be at risk of further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ment to extract water from your tile floors, including wet vacuums, pumps, and hoses. Our technicians will work quickly to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Setting up drying equipment to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. Our technicians will also use industrial-strength fans to circulate air and promote evaporation.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Thoroughly cleaning the affected area to remove dirt, debris, and bacteria. Our technicians will also apply a sanitizing agent to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Disinfection
Inspecting the area to ensure that all water has been removed and the area is dry. Our technicians will also apply a disinfectant to prevent the spread of bacteria and other microorganisms.

Warning Signs You Need Tile Floor Water Extraction
Ignoring the warning sign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Here are some common signs that you need tile floor water extraction: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can be a sign of water damage or mold growth.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Visible signs of water damage, such as warped or buckled flooring, can be a clear indication that you need tile floor water extraction. Don’t ignore these warning signs, as they can lead to further damage.
Water Stains or Rings
Visible water stains or rings on your tile floors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these marks,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Peeling or Cracking Paint or Wallpaper
Visible signs of water damage, such as peeling or cracking paint or wallpaper, can be a clear indication that you need tile floor water extraction. Don’t ignore these warning signs, as they can lead to further damage.
Water Damage in Hidden Areas
Hidden areas such as behind walls or under flooring, can be prone to water damage. If you notice signs of water damage in these areas,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Tile Floor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ill | Yes | No | You can likely handle a small spill yourself with some basic cleaning supplies. |
| Large water spill or flood | No | Yes | A large water spill or flood need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ract water and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age in hidden areas | No | Yes | Hidden areas, such as behind walls or under flooring, can be prone to water damage and need professional expertise to detect and repair. |
| Water damage that’s not visible | No | Yes | Water damage that’s not visible can be hidden behind walls, under flooring, or in other hard-to-reach areas, needing professional expertise to detect and repair. |
| Water damage that’s causing structural issues | No | Yes | Water damage that’s causing structural issues, such as warping or buckling flooring, needs professional expertise to repair and prevent further damage. |

Tile Floor Water Extraction Cost in Arlington, WA
The cost of tile floor water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here’s a rough estimate of what you might expect to pay: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ment | $100-$500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area. |
| Water Extraction | $500-$2,500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500-$2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$200-$1,000 | Size of affected area and type of cleaning equipment needed. |
| Final Inspection and Disinfection | $100-$500 | Size of affected area and type of disinfection equipment needed. |
The final cost of tile floor water extraction will depend on the specific services needed and the severity of the damage. We offer free estimates to help you understand the cost and scope of the work.
